Choosing a name for a boy dog that starts with the letter N can be an exciting process. The name you select can reflect your dog's personality, appearance, or even your personal preferences. Here are some detailed considerations and suggestions to help you make an informed decision.

Firstly, consider the breed and physical characteristics of your dog. Names that reflect these traits can be both meaningful and endearing. For example, if your dog has a sleek, black coat, you might consider names like Night or Noir. Alternatively, if your dog is particularly energetic, names like Nitro or Navigator could be fitting.

Next, think about your dog's personality. Is he playful, calm, or adventurous? For a playful dog, names like Nugget, Ninja, or Nemo might be suitable. If your dog is more laid-back, consider names like Newton or Nero. For an adventurous pup, names like Nimbus or Navigator could be perfect.

Additionally, you might want to consider names that have personal significance to you. This could be a name that honors a family member, a favorite character from a book or movie, or even a name that you find aesthetically pleasing. For instance, if you admire famous figures, names like Napoleon, Nelson, or Neil could be appropriate. If you prefer names from mythology, consider names like Narcissus or Neptune.

When selecting a name, it's also important to consider how it sounds when called. Choose a name that is easy to pronounce and distinguish from common commands. Additionally, consider how the name will sound when paired with commands such as "sit," "stay," or "come." For example, "Nero sit" might sound more distinctive than "Nate sit."

Lastly, involve your family or household members in the naming process. Getting everyone's input can make the decision more enjoyable and ensure that the chosen name is well-received by all. Once you have a shortlist of names, try them out for a few days to see which one feels right. You might find that a name that seemed perfect on paper doesn't quite fit your dog's personality, or vice versa.
